[Asia Economy Reporter Cha Min-young] kt cs announced on the 10th that with the construction of the Boramae Contact Center, it has established a total of 1,200 seats of AICC (AI Contact Center) infrastructure in Seoul, including its first building, the Yeomchang Contact Center.


kt cs is advancing into an AICC that combines contact center operation know-how with artificial intelligence (AI) solutions to provide consultation. To address issues that arose in call centers after the COVID-19 pandemic, it launched the AI solution 'HiQri' last March to assist consultation tasks.


The Boramae Contact Center has a total of 600 seats and has been operating since April of this year. Healing programs are also being introduced, such as utilizing Boramae Park, to enhance employee job satisfaction.



Kim Jae-kyung, head of the Contact Solutions Division at kt cs, said, “In the future, the key for customer centers will be how to combine the human intelligence of consultants’ know-how with AI to provide the best customer experience.”
